CometChip: A High-throughput 96-Well Platform for Measuring DNA Damage in Microarrayed Human Cells
Jing Ge *1, Somsak Prasongtanakij *2, David K. Wood 3, David M. Weingeist 1, Jessica Fessler 1, Panida Navasummrit 2, Mathuros Ruchirawat 2, Bevin P. Engelward 1
1Department of Biological Engineering, Massachusetts Institute of Technology, 2Environmental Toxicology, Chulabhorn Graduate Institute, 3Department of Biomedical Engineering, University of Minnesota

We describe here a platform that allows comet assay detection of DNA damage with unprecedented throughput. The device patterns mammalian cells into a microarray and enables parallel processing of 96 samples. The approach facilitates analysis of base level DNA damage, exposure-induced DNA damage and DNA repair kinetics.
